 Partial Dentures

If you’re missing just one or a few teeth, a partial denture is an accessible option – less expensive than implants – that will help you bite and chew again. Plus, a partial denture will make it look like you have a full set of teeth.

A partial denture is a removable dental appliance that replaces the missing teeth in the mouth. You may need a partial denture for aesthetic reasons, or for eating, talking or to protect remaining teeth from drifting or over-erupting.

Partial dentures are not fixed – they can be inserted and removed whenever you like. This works by using your remaining teeth for retention, so it retains and stabilises the denture (holds it in place) so that it doesn’t move or fall.

Implant-supported dentures 

Your teeth, health and well-being matter more than anything. Everyone should be able to eat well, talk easily – and – not suffer the detrimental loss of vital bone tissue. Without natural teeth, your jawbone gradually disintegrates and facial features slowly fall in. With implant-supported dentures, you can now prevent detrimental bone loss.

Benefits of implant dentures

  •  Fewer pressure sores, pain and irritation to the gum tissue
  • Much better fit, with greatly increased security
  • More natural feel in the mouth due to both increase security and less plastic used 
  • Improved speech
  • Improved nutrition due to a wider variety of foods able to be eaten
  • No denture adhesives are required
  • Increased confidence when talking & eating as the fear of dentures slippage is gone.
